Submittal Fields

The submittal fields contain the details of the submittal, including what is needed, who is completing the information, and when it is due.

Note: For some of the following fields, the names of the fields may be different in your instance of Viewpoint Team because they can be customized by the system administrator.

When entering a contact, you can filter the list of contacts to select one or add a new contact.

To filter the list of contacts:

  • Enter the first few letters of the contact's name to filter the list.
  • Select Team Contacts to filter the list to contacts in your enterprise.
  • Select PM Firm/Spectrum Contacts to filter the list to just contacts from your ERP system.

To add a Team user (someone who has a Team user account), enter the full email address associated with that user. Note this is not required if your enterprise is configured to limit contacts to Vista PM firms.

To add a new contact, click New Contact.

Table 1. Submittal Fields
FieldDescription
Spec SectionEnter the first few characters of specification section related to the submittal and select it from the list. To add a new section, enter the complete specification section up to 20 characters and click New Spec Section.
Number (Required)Enter a unique identifier for the submittal.
Title (Required)Enter a title or subject for the submittal, up to 60 characters.
TypeSelect the submittal type from the list to be able to sort and filter by type later.
SubmitterSelect the project contact who is responsible for completing the submittal.
PackageEnter the first few characters of the package related to the submittal and select it from the list. To add a new package, enter the package up to 50 characters and click New Package.
DescriptionEnter a description for the submittal, up to 60 characters.
ReviewerSelect the project contact who is responsible for reviewing the submittal.
Additional ReviewersSelect any additional project contacts who should also review the submittal. Additional reviewers can respond to the submittal but cannot change the state of the submittal.
ApproverSelect the project contact who is responsible for approving the submittal.
Additional ApproversSelect any additional project contacts who should also approve the submittal.
CCSelect any additional contacts who should know about the submittal. These contacts can:
  • View the submittal
  • Receive notifications
  • Add comments
PrioritySelect the option for the priority of the Submittal:
  • Low
  • Medium
  • High
Depending on the project settings, the priority may determine the default due date.
Due on Site ByEnter the date to deliver the submittal items to the work site.
Lead DaysEnter the number of days notice the submitter needs for the submittal. This lead time allows the submitter time to gather the information needed for the submittal.
Due to SubmitterEnter the date to deliver the submittal to the submitter.
Note: If Default Review Days are enabled for the project, this date auto-adjusts to ensure the default review days are provided.
Due from SubmitterEnter the date the submitter should return the submittal.
Note: If Default Review Days are enabled for the project, this date auto-adjusts to ensure the default review days are provided.
Due to ApproverEnter the date to deliver the submittal to the approver.
Note: If Default Review Days are enabled for the project, this date auto-adjusts to ensure the default review days are provided.
Due from ApproverEnter the date the approver should return the submittal.
Note: If Default Review Days are enabled for the project, this date auto-adjusts to ensure the default review days are provided.
ReferenceEnter reference information for the submittal.

NoteEnter any notes about the submittal.
Notify Recipients (Available once a work item has been created, and enabled by default.) If you do not wish to send email notifications to the reviewer and those included in the CC field, you can clear the Notify Recipients checkbox.
